New Mexico Restraining Orders Step 1: Go to court and request an application. Step 2: Fill out the petition. Step 3: A judge will review your petition and assign a court date. Step 4: Service of process. Step 5: What will I have to prove at the hearing? Step 6: The hearing.
Either party may at any time file a written motion with the court requesting a hearing to dissolve or modify the order. Proceedings to modify or dissolve a protective order shall be given precedence on the docket of the court.

If you believe the protection order was granted improperly or that it is no longer needed, you can file a motion asking the court to ?dissolve? (terminate or cancel) the protection order. After you file the motion, the court will decide whether or not to schedule a hearing.
You can file a civil restraining order against almost anyone who you do not have a domestic relationship with, but it requires a $132.00 filing fee.
A peace officer may arrest without a warrant and take into custody a restrained party whom the peace officer has probable cause to believe has violated an order of protection that is issued pursuant to the Family Violence Protection Act or entitled to full faith and credit.
A domestic violence protective order remains in effect until 1 of 3 things happen: (1) the charges are dropped by the prosecutor (called a nolle), (2) the charges are dismissed by the Court at trial; or (3) the court grants a motion for modification of the protective order prior to the conclusion of your case.
